<em>New Problem:</em>
<em>Find (g ∘ f)(10) when f(x) = 3x - 1 and g(x) = 2x + 3</em>
<em />
<u>Solution:</u>
The notation <em>(g ∘ f)(10) </em>means take the function "f" and put it into "g" and then evaluate that expression with "10". First, lets find <em>(g ∘ f)(x).</em>
<em />
f(x) = 3x - 1
g(x) = 2x + 3
(g ∘ f)(x) = 2(3x - 1) + 3
= 6x - 2 + 3
= 6x + 1
So,
(g ∘ f)(x) = 6x + 1
Now,
(g ∘ f)(10) = 6(10) + 1 = <u>61</u>
